India Halts US-Bound Mail Bookings Amid Tariff Disputes

Suspension of Mail Services

In a significant development amid ongoing trade tensions, India has announced a temporary suspension of mail bookings destined for the United States. This decision impacts various types of mail, including letters and gifts valued up to $100. The move comes as both nations navigate a complex tariff landscape, creating uncertainty for individuals and businesses reliant on mailing services.

Details of the Suspension

The suspension affects all categories of international mail, particularly those containing items such as personal letters and small gifts. The Indian postal service emphasized that this restriction is a direct response to the fluctuating tariff situations that have arisen from a protracted trade dispute between India and the US. As of now, there is no specified date for when these services will resume, raising concerns among many who rely on these mailing options for personal and business communication.

Impact on Consumers and Businesses

This suspension could have a ripple effect on consumers and businesses that depend on sending parcels and letters to the US. For example, individuals sending birthday gifts or holiday cards may find themselves looking for alternative solutions, potentially increasing the demand for courier services, which could be more costly. Furthermore, businesses that operate with international clients may experience delays in communication and product shipments, thereby affecting their operations.

Context of the Tariff War

The trade tensions between India and the United States have intensified over the past few years, marked by tariffs imposed on various goods and services. This ongoing tariff war has not only impacted larger trade agreements but has also trickled down to individual consumer services, such as mail. The postal services have become a collateral aspect of this larger economic conflict, illustrating how global trade issues can affect everyday life.
